Full Description

The following text is from the original listed building designation:
1. 5280 CHEVENING BESSELS GREEN Bessels Green Road The Baptist Church. Manse. (Formerly listed as Vicarage) TQ 5055 5/174 10.9.54.
II
2. Church: Mid C18 building of painted brick with half hipped tiled roof. 1 small C19 dormer. 2 tall round-headed windows with square panes. In centre small lunette, with fancy margin lights, above projecting, slated early C19 porch with ornamental barge-boards and Gothick panelled door. Tudor arched fanlight over with Gothick tracery. Manse adjoining to right has C19 porch and French window on ground floor. Casement above under shallow segmental arch. 1 storey, 1 window right extension.
